Output e66eb485288feb6c93b0eea72f7bc751bc87eab67813af6e8aaed04877db12a7:2

value
15613527
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f8a83547f8e28cd004290c62a2b6a36ba8bcd25 OP_EQUAL
address
3K9nvEdn4cfia7mmztQBPbn27eaArvupCB
transaction
e66eb485288feb6c93b0eea72f7bc751bc87eab67813af6e8aaed04877db12a7
spent
true